数据传输的挑战
在数字化时代,数据传输变得不可或缺。然而,这一过程中出现错误和丢失是常见的问题,无损检测技术正是为了解决这一问题而诞生的。它通过检测数据在传输过程中的任何改变,从而保证信息的完整性。
原理与应用
无损检测通常基于两种不同的方法:加密和编码。在加密方式中,原始数据被使用某种算法转换成无法读懂的形式,然后再进行传输。当接收方使用相反的算法解密时,只有没有发生变化的情况下,才能正确恢复原始数据。而编码方式则通过添加冗余信息来提高可靠性,即使在部分信息丢失的情况下,也能够还原出原始内容。
常见协议与标准
为了实现无损检测,有多个协议和标准得到了广泛应用。例如,TCP(Transmission Control Protocol)是一种常用的网络通信协议,它通过检验序列号(sequence number)来确保数据包按顺序到达,并且可以重发丢失或受损的分组。如果发现分组未能成功到达,就会重新发送该分组直至确认收到为止。
安全性的重要性
随着互联网技术的发展,网络攻击如假冒、窃听等越来越猖獗。因此,无损检测不仅仅是保证文件完整性的手段,更是一个防御网络安全威胁的手段。在金融交易、电子投票系统以及敏感信息处理等领域,无损检测技术尤其重要,因为它们直接关系到个人隐私保护和企业利益安全。
未来展望与挑战
随着大数据、云计算、大规模分布式系统等新兴技术不断发展,无损检测也需要不断创新以适应新的需求。一方面,要面对更高效率、高性能和更低成本的要求;另一方面,还要考虑如何有效地处理异构系统间的大规模交互,以及如何应对未来的网络攻击手段,以确保持续提升无损检测能力。